Applicant was granted bail by this Court vide order dated 03/10/2018 passed in Bail Application No. 1816 of 2018. Applicant was permitted to furnish cash security in the sum of Rs. 25,000/- for a period of 6 weeks. Applicant was directed to be released on bail on furnishing P.R. bond in the sum of Rs. 25,000/- with one or more

2 501.1463.18 appp.doc sureties in the like amount.

The learned Advocate for the applicant submits that applicant has already furnished documents with regards to surety, however, verification is awaited and hence it will take some more time to execute the surety. It is therefore submitted that the facility of cash security granted by this Court be extended by period of 6 weeks to enable him to furnish surety.

In view of the submissions, facility of cash security granted by this Court vide order dated 03/10/2018 is extended for period of 6 weeks to enable the applicant to furnish surety, in accordance with order dated 03/10/2018 passed in Bail Application no. 1816 of 2018.

Application stands disposed of.
